Holloaks’ Theresa McQueen to ’cause havoc’


Theresa McQueen will "cause havoc" when she returns to 'Hollyoaks'.
The notorious loudmouth - played by Jorgie Porter - will return to the Channel 4 soap in spectacular fashion, producer Bryan Kirkwood has promised.
Theresa is currently in prison after being found guilty of Calvin Valentine's murder but she will soon be reunited with the rest of the McQueen clan.
Talking to Inside Soap magazine, Bryan teased: "Jorgie Porter is filming with us again and it's a delight to have her back. We underused Theresa in her last year in the show, so now we will see a renewed, reinvigorated Theresa causing havoc in all the right - and wrong - places.
"She will get out of prison, but how she manages this remains to be seen."
The producer also revealed that there will be two new characters arriving in Chester who will mix things up for the McQueen family.
He said: "This autumn will see the arrival of an extended branch of the McQueen family as we meet Myra's nieces. We are starting the casting process now and I am so excited to be breathing new life into the show's most iconic family."
Additionally, there will be justice for John Paul McQueen (James Sutton), who is recovering from a brutal sex attack at the hands of Finn O'Connor (Keith Rice).
Byran explained: "We have closely followed advice from male rape survivors and wanted to send a clear message that, although it can take time for victims of male rape to come forward, this won't prevent them from being listened to, or mean that their attacker will not face the full force of the law.
"Rest assured that for John Paul, justice will prevail."

Michelle Keegan plans ‘Tina shrine’ in new home


Michelle Keegan will have a "Tina shrine" in her new home.
The 'Coronation Street' beauty - whose character Tina McIntyre was killed off in May - has revealed plans to dedicate an area of her new home in Essex, which she will share with fiancé Mark Wright, to her soap alter-ego as a reminder of her six years on the show.
Speaking to Lucie Cave on heat radio, she said: "I have got loads of pictures from the past, with Chris Gascoyne [Peter Barlow] and more all stacked up ready to go into my new home. So I will be taking her with me - it will be a Tina shrine.
"I do miss Tina a lot, I do miss her and I do miss 'Corrie'. But it was just the right time for me [to leave]."
Michelle, 27, has already lined up her next acting role but is eager not to give away too many details.
She explained: "I want to continue acting just because it's something that I love to do and I have been auditioning again. I can't say too much because it's not 100 per cent signed, but there is a job in the pipeline."
The stunning actress has ruled out any plans to follow fellow soap stars Martine McCutcheon and Holly Valance into the music industry, however, as Michelle openly admits she's a terrible singer.
She said: "I'd love to be able to sing. That's the one thing I'd love to be able to do. When I'm drunk that's another thing that I do - overconfident, I get on the mic at karaoke and think I can sing like Celine Dion. I can't."

Dragon Piers Linney not surprised by Bannatyne exit


Piers Linney says 'Dragons' Den' stalwart Duncan Bannatyne "will be missed".
The Scottish entrepreneur, 65, has amassed a huge fortune across a number of industries and after 12 series of the BBC Two show recently decided that now is the right time to walk away.
Fellow Dragon Piers said the decision has come as no surprise, telling the Metro newspaper: "I think he was just ready to go.
"He is very insightful and has a particular talent for just cutting through everything. He will be missed but I'm also looking forward to seeing who they bring in, or what happens next."
New episodes of the popular show are set to air this week and Piers - the co-founder of successful IT company Outsourcery - says that he was keen to build on his business successes in the new series.
He explained: "You make a decision and you take quite big punts. But I think in Series 12, I come into my own a bit.
"There are a few interesting tech-driven, or e-commerce businesses and with tech you have to go big or go home."
The new series of 'Dragons' Den' starts on Sunday (20.07.14) on BBC Two.

BGT winner Jamie Lambert reveals he’s gay


Collabro's Jamie Lambert has come out as gay.
The 25-year-old singer - who is one fifth of the 'Britain's Got Talent' winning boy band - has admitted he has always known he was homosexual and he would have revealed his sexuality sooner but he didn't think it was a big deal.
In an interview with The Sun newspaper, he explained: "No one asked - I have nothing to hide from anybody. I think it's really important that all gay people in the public eye just talk about it. The more that it happens the more normal it becomes.
"I remember when Stephen Gately (from boy band Boyzone) came out and it was a really massive deal. But I think nowadays it's about being comfortable in your own skin and comfortable with who you fall in love with.
"It doesn't make a difference whether it's with a man or a woman."
Jamie has never had a relationship with a woman but has had a committed romance with another guy who he met when he was a student.
He said: "I've never been with a woman. One day I met a guy at university who I ended up in a two-and-a-half year relationship with."
As the winners of 'Britain's Got Talent', Collabro have just landed a record deal with Simon Cowell's label Syco but as their fame rises, Jamie is hopeful that he won't become known as "the gay one" of the group.
He said: "It's only an aspect of me, just like it's only an aspect of these guys who are straight. It's not all of who I am. I would hate for people to see me as 'the gay one', rather than the one who sings that line."

Nik and Eva Speakman set for I’m A Celeb…


TV life coaches Nik and Eva Speakman are set to become contestants on 'I'm A Celebrity... Get Me Out of Here!'
Bosses want the couple - who have their own ITV show 'The Speakmans' on which the psychotherapists help people overcome various disorders - to join the other campmates so they can be on hand to help any stars with phobias beat their fears.
A source told the Daily Star newspaper: "The Speakmans have the power to make life heaven or hell for the stars. If someone is a big scaredy cat and keeps being punished by viewers, they might feel pity for them and help cure their phobias.
"But if they can't stand the star, they could just refuse and let them suffer. It will also test their powers in front on millions."
As well their TV show, Nik and Eva are regulars on 'This Morning' and even helped presenter Holly Willoughby overcome her fear of the supernatural.
They also worked with Kerry Katona to help her beat her bipolar disorder by using unorthodox treatments such as "crazy games", "mad music" and playing with a skeleton who they named 'Mr. Bones'.
'I'm A Celebrity...' - presented by Ant and Dec - is set to returns to screens later this year.





Jeremy Kyle pepper-sprayed in Magaluf


Jeremy Kyle was pepper-sprayed by a nightclub bouncer in Magaluf.
The television presenter - who is known for interrogating unfaithful partners on 'The Jeremy Kyle Show' - was visiting the party resort on the Spanish island of Mallorca with a crew of cameramen when he was warned by a bouncer to keep away.
'Gogglebox' star Scarlett Moffatt said in her column for the Daily Star newspaper: "It was clear to all that Jeremiah wasn't making a show to promote Maga and wanted to dish the dirt in the name of shock entertainment where his viewers can judge what they don't understand.
"While he may've thought clubbers too wasted to recognise how out of place he looked, he didn't account for the workers unprepared for their beloved party island to face another slagging.
"And one bouncer from one of the busiest bars warned Jezza that he couldn't come into the club."
Scarlett - who has also appeared on MTV reality series 'Beauty School Cop Outs' - claimed Jeremy's "mooching around" was bad for business and resulted in the bouncer taking matters into his own hands.
She added: "It ended with Jezza being pepper-sprayed by the bouncer and the poor fella was as confused as one of his show guests getting a full-house on the lie detector machine."

Billie Faiers: Sam was ‘natural’ midwife


Billie Faiers says her sister Sam was a "natural" midwife during her labour.
'The Only Way is Essex' star - who gave birth to her first daughter with fiancé Greg Shepherd last Thursday (10.07.14) - has revealed her younger sibling has a surprising talent for midwifery after helping her through the painful delivery.
She told Britain's OK! magazine: "She was amazing and proved to be a complete natural as a midwife! She'd been a birthing partner for one of our best friends twice, so she came in the room and was like a midwife. She started to massage my back and knew exactly what to do!"
Billie admits she is still getting over the pain of her delivery.
She added: "My whole body is still in shock. I've never experienced anything like that pain in my life. You can't explain it."
Meanwhile, the 24 year old - who has starred on the hit ITV2 reality show since 2010 - is struggling to agree with Greg on a name for their baby girl.
She explained: "We just haven't decided, it's so difficult. We've been Googling names and looking at her saying, 'Does she look like this?'
"All the women in our family have Elizabeth as their middle name so I think that will be hers.
"Greg liked the name Skyla but I was like, 'No way!' "
